Copper Alloys - an overview | ScienceDirect Topics

The alloy designation system serves to identify the type of material, as shown in Table 3.2. Alloys 101 to 199 are high-grade copper with very few alloys added. Alloys 201 to 299 are brasses (mainly copper and zinc). Alloys 501 to 665 are bronzes, composed of copper and elements other than zinc. Other properties of copper alloys are also shown.

1.25Cr-0.5Mo | 1.25Cr-0.5Mo-Si - Piping & Pipeline

2020921 · The 1.25Cr-0.5Mo (also known as “1-1/4Cr-1/2Mo”) steel is a typical low alloy heat-resistant steel of the Cr-Mo steel family. It is widely used for applications at elevated temperatures. The figures “1.25” and “0.5” denote the nominal chemical composition of chromium and molybdenum alloying elements respectively.

ISO - ISO 4527:2003 - Metallic coatings — Autocatalytic

ISO 4527:2003 specifies the requirements and test methods for autocatalytic nickel-phosphorus alloy coatings applied from aqueous solutions on to metallic substrates. This International Standard does not apply to autocatalytic nickel-boron alloy coatings, nickel-phosphorus composites and ternary alloys.
